9117 E Nassau Ave, Denver, CO 80237 is a 4 bedroom, 3 bathroom, 1,600 sqft single-family home in Hampden South, built in 1965. More recently, it was listed as a rental in April 2026 with an asking price of $2,595 per month. That rental listing was removed on May 1, 2026. It is currently off market. The Trulia Estimate is $398,400, with a rent estimate of $2,621/month.
